Reese’s Peanut Butter Cups are a popular American confection combining creamy peanut butter and smooth milk chocolate. Originating in the U.S., this iconic treat is known for its perfect balance of sweet and salty flavors. Each cup contains ingredients such as milk chocolate, sugar, cocoa butter, skim milk, peanuts, and dextrose. While Reese’s Cups are a source of protein and provide quick energy from carbohydrates, they are high in sugar, saturated fats, and calories, which may not align with certain dietary goals. This indulgent snack has become a staple in Western cuisine, often enjoyed in moderation as a satisfying dessert or treat.
